Internal Memo — Budget Request

To the sales leads: Operations has submitted a budget request to fund two additional demo kits for the Vellane product line and travel support for the Ashgrove territory push. Finance expects a decision within two weeks. No changes to current spending limits until then; log any urgent needs with your regional coordinator. Background on the request's purpose appears below.

board note of fahaf-fadug: Gilixax Logistics is in early talks to buy Praiusax Partners for about $8.1 million. The Pramir launch date is September 23, and nothing goes to the press before then.

Subject: DR drill — font vendoring pipeline

Hi, as part of Friday's disaster-recovery drill we'll restore the Glyphden repository that vendors our licensed typefaces. Please review the restore diff carefully: checksums for every vendored font must match the manifest before merge. The encrypted license bundle will need unsealing during restore, using the recovery passphrase provided below.

recovery phrase for fawif-tajeg: norael-aldmir-casir-brivan-ulaion

HANDOVER NOTE — Large-Deal Discounting

As you take over the Vostrel commercial directorate, the discount framework for large deals will need your early attention. Current policy caps standard discounts at 12%, with exceptions up to 20% requiring my sign-off; in practice, the Harwyn and Delmont accounts have pushed well past that, and my predecessor's side agreements still bind us through year-end. Orla Fennick in deal desk maintains the exception log and can walk you through each case. Before approving anything new, please read the following.

board note of kagep-yahig: Only 9 of the 120 pilot accounts renewed Quenix, so a churn review is set for April 1.

### Step 4: Update the replica-lag alarm

Plugin authors targeting Fernwick 3.x must rework their read-replica lag alarms. The old polling hook is removed; lag is now pushed by the coordinator, so your plugin should subscribe rather than poll. Thresholds are no longer hardcoded and must come from the shared config. After migration, your plugin should load the following values:

settings of fafog-haduf:
ZORIX_PIN=4648
ZORIX_METRICS_HOST=metrics.zorix.paliqsys.corp
ZORIX_LOG_LEVEL=info
ZORIX_TENANT=druix